程序的组成是什么结构

时间:2025-01-26 14:04:42 手机游戏

程序的基本构成要素通常包括以下几个方面:

常量:

常量是在程序执行过程中不会改变的固定值。例如,数学中的圆周率π或物理中的光速。

变量:

变量是程序中用于存储数据的标识符,其值可以在程序执行过程中改变。例如,计数器或用户输入的数据。

表达式:

表达式是由常量、变量、运算符(如加、减、乘、除)和函数调用等组成的数学或逻辑语句,用于计算或表示一个值。

语句:

语句是程序中的基本执行单元,用于执行特定的操作。例如,赋值语句、条件语句(if-else)、循环语句(for、while)等。

函数:

函数是一段可重用的代码块,用于执行特定任务并可能返回一个结果。函数通常包括参数和返回值。

控制结构:

程序的执行通常遵循一定的流程,包括顺序结构、选择结构(如if-else语句)和循环结构(如for、while循环)。

数据结构:

数据结构是计算机存储和组织数据的方式,如数组、链表、树、图等。

库和模块:

程序可能包含对标准库或用户自定义库的引用,这些库提供了预定义的函数和类,用于实现常见功能。

输入/输出操作:

程序通常需要从外部获取数据(输入)并将结果输出到外部(如文件或控制台)。

错误处理和调试:

程序应包含错误处理机制,以便在遇到问题时能够优雅地处理错误并进行调试。

这些要素共同构成了程序的基本框架,使得程序能够按照预定的逻辑执行任务。不同的程序设计语言可能会以不同的方式实现这些要素,但它们的基本原理和目的是相似的。